I think the major problem with this is that almost all groups do (or should) have an enchanter on staff, which will mean the bard's CC, slow, and group haste abilities are completely redundant. While the mana regen is nice, a group is usually better served from an EXP standpoint by picking up another dps. I reckon this is just my opinion though as an enchanter.
It's very easy to say "every group should have an enchanter" but you can't always find an enchanter, and a bard is often an excellent second choice. Even if you do have an enchanter, that enchanter doesn't often slow a lot of monsters in my experience (since they're too busy doing other things), nor does he pull. Bards can pick up that slack.

Best puller I had on live was a bard. He'd chain single pulls with lull if he happened to get an add he'd mezz or charm one and have it fight the other to get both low while we finished the current kills. XP always flew by when he was around. Haven't seen any bards that do that here. Most just play Anthem De Arms or Hymn of Restoration one at a time but I haven't grouped with many so I'm not saying there aren't any that don't.
